Output 5076e1b1edd9ad33992899c40b4828f38781bcda013c4901a3eb9853cb64ce2a:4

value
56956
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75bdb548b819c892a583d77269cfbac279985f55 OP_EQUAL
address
3CRaF97JSs93nVnwtp8qhtE2Vnko2KFvh9
transaction
5076e1b1edd9ad33992899c40b4828f38781bcda013c4901a3eb9853cb64ce2a
spent
true